For most adults, orthodontic treatment takes anywhere from 12 to 24 months, though some cases may be shorter or longer depending on individual needs.
What Affects Your Treatment Timeline
Several variables influence how long your treatment will take, and these factors are unique to each patient. A personalized consultation is always the best first step to getting a clear picture of your timeline.
The Complexity of Your Case
Minor spacing or crowding issues may resolve in as few as six months, while more complex alignment problems typically require a longer commitment. Adults often present with bite issues that developed over the years, and those conditions can add to the overall treatment time.
Your Dental Health at the Start
Adult teeth are fully developed and more firmly set in the jaw than a child’s, which means movement tends to happen at a slower pace. According to the American Association of Orthodontists, adult treatment may take longer than treatment for younger patients because fully developed teeth require more time and consistent pressure to shift into position. Addressing any existing dental concerns, such as gum disease or decay, before beginning orthodontics is also important and can affect when you’re ready to start.
The Treatment Type You Choose
Different treatments come with different timelines. Clear aligners often work faster for mild to moderate cases, while traditional braces may be recommended for more involved corrections. Discussing these options with your orthodontist is the best way to find the right fit.
Treatment Options and Their Estimated Timelines
The treatment you choose plays a major role in determining your overall duration. Here is a general breakdown of what you can typically expect:
- Traditional braces: Generally 18 to 24 months for adults, though more complex cases may extend beyond that range
- Clear ceramic braces: A similar timeline to traditional braces, with the added benefit of a more discreet appearance during treatment
- Invisalign for adults: Generally 12 to 18 months for mild to moderate cases, provided aligners are worn for 20 to 22 hours per day as directed.
- Accelerated orthodontic treatment: Some patients may qualify for approaches designed to significantly shorten their overall treatment time
Each case is different, and these ranges serve as general guides rather than promises. Your specific timeline will be discussed and confirmed during your initial consultation.
How to Keep Your Treatment on Track
Your habits during treatment have a direct effect on how quickly you progress. Patients who closely follow their orthodontist’s guidance consistently tend to see the best results in the most efficient timeframe.
Wear Your Aligners as Directed
For Invisalign patients, wearing your trays for the recommended number of hours each day is non-negotiable. Skipping wear time extends your treatment and may compromise your results.
Attend All Scheduled Appointments
Missing adjustment appointments delays progress. Regular check-ins allow our team to monitor tooth movement, make necessary corrections, and keep treatment moving forward on schedule.
Prioritize Oral Hygiene
Gum problems or tooth decay during treatment can pause your progress entirely. Brushing, flossing, and staying current with dental cleanings protects your investment and helps keep things on track.
